One item I learnt during the day was that customers don't care about web to print. (Web to print? I forgot to say what it is. It is a software system that allows customers to order on line. Vistaprint are experts at it.) So they don't care, yes, that makes sense; its easier to ring up and say could I have 500 business cards. Web to print sales people emphasize the downside of traditional systems, the to-ing and fro-ing between printer and customer. From the customer's point of view the advantage is that the&amp;nbsp;responsibility&amp;nbsp;for errors is left with the printer. Even today this was highlighted as one of our customers had us design the art work; they were to send the completed art work to an on-line printers; we then 'wasted' much time helping the customer sending their art work to the on-line printers. several variations on the art work, emails left right and centre, phone calls to the on-line printers customer support. Web to print companies cope by stonewalling and fobbing off customers.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;I was told that Vistaprint has a 20% complaint rate, true or not it hasn't stopped them succeeding as a company. Then, as I review my print jobs I realized that to turn our business into a full web to print enterprise would be nigh on impossible unless I removed most of my catalogue. Web to print companies specialize in a limited range of products, such as flyers and business cards. Print shop such as the Minuteman Press outlets specialize in not specializing.... raffle tickets, posters, brochures, file conversion, forms, diaries, calendars, wedding stationery, business cards, copying, faxing, overprint of pens, newsletters etc. Attempting to computerize all this would be a challenge. Another common factor of these systems is the extraordinary expense of installing them, £3000 for setting them up, £500 a month charged. Forget it. There are cheaper options available but they tend to be a bit clunky.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Moving on, it turns out we are already using web to print, in part; web to print includes a whole range of technologies and many printers will have some of them... email marketing, electronic pricing, web sites, templates. Yes I need to make sure my other site has a site map too.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/2407249727482800198-1105347687076722352?l=minutemanstockport.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://minutemanstockport.blogspot.com/feeds/1105347687076722352/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://minutemanstockport.blogspot.com/2011/01/all-things-to-with-web-site.html#comment-form'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/2407249727482800198/posts/default/1105347687076722352'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/2407249727482800198/posts/default/1105347687076722352'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://minutemanstockport.blogspot.com/2011/01/all-things-to-with-web-site.html' title='All things to with a web site'/><author><name>Minuteman Stockport</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/01375160561324084389</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='32' height='24' src='http://2.bp.blogspot.com/_gDokFYWhp-Y/Sz5DFByJZ7I/AAAAAAAAAAk/vh3d_OLN1Kc/S220/shop.jpg'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-2407249727482800198.post-1972337741073633083</id><published>2010-08-25T21:49:00.000+01:00</published><updated>2010-08-25T21:49:56.433+01:00</updated><title type='text'>Colour printers</title><content type='html'>Looking back it is easy to see why the previous owners of the business didn't take on the lease to change the ancient digital printing devises&amp;nbsp; It is a minefield of options and heavy sales techniques, and potential expense. The first option is continuing to use a Xerox machine.&amp;nbsp; I'll leave that hanging because I don't want to get sued for libel. It was suggested we report Xerox to Stockport trading standards, last week.&amp;nbsp; Maybe. I was keen to buy into Toshiba, they make a nice machine that my research showed had a reliable performance and good service record. A new machine would cost less than £10000, to give an indication of their value.&amp;nbsp; Its main advantage from my perspective would be a reduced lease outlay.&amp;nbsp; However, the 'click' cost compared unfavourably with the other contenders, Oci and Konica Minolta Direct who are marketing a heavy duty machine called the 5501. Probably over £20000 to buy new. Oci seem OK but remain an unknown quantity in comparison to Konica Minolta. They are offering a redundant machine in comparison with Oci who are offering a new machine.&amp;nbsp; The latter's 'click' charge is slightly more expensive, making the KM a better deal; the main disadvantage being that the KM machine is a second hand machine. It seems that the extra expense means that our outgoings remain the same, not a realistic option because one of the aims of the exercise is to reduce our outgoings. The final element in the mix is the finance; normally one buys via a lease; not the best of arrangements it seems to me, we never seem to own the machine and the costs seem high.&amp;nbsp; Alternatively we could buy the machine out right; thirdly we could borrow money to buy one.&amp;nbsp; The latter seems a good option to me; the interest rates would probably be lower.
